Joseph A. Schumpeter

was an Austrian economist, finance minister of Austria and Professor at Harvard University who dedicated his thought to the examination of the tendency of growth in capitalistic systems. He coined the expression of “creative destruction” which occurs when inventions and innovations lead to the abolishment of old techniques and the rising of a new one.

 

Central Works

  • The Theory of Development,
  • Business Cycles: A Theoretical, Historical and Statistical Analysis of the Capitalist Process,
  • Capitalism, Socialism and Democracy
